Polly Ann Canady 1902 - 1975

Polly Ann Canady of Hurley, Grant County, NM was born on September 22, 1902, and died at age 72 years old on February 27, 1975. Polly Canady was buried at Ft. Bayard National Cemetery Section A Row T Site 38 200 Camino De Paz, in Fort Bayard.

In 1902, in the year that Polly Ann Canady was born, the Aswan Low Dam (the old Aswan Dam) began construction in Egypt in 1899 and was completed in 1902 - making it the largest masonry dam in the world at the time. The dam was built on the Nile River in order to conserve water and regulate flooding, allowing for population increase along the Nile.
